post-synaptic potential

After binding a neurotransmitter packet of 1000 to 10,000 molecules, post-synaptic membrane changes 1 mV to 15 mV {post-synaptic potential} (PSP), with average of 10 mV, lasting 10 to 100 milliseconds. Initial change is rapid, and decay is slow. Potential change affects membrane up to two millimeters away. Spontaneous neurotransmitter release makes changes of 0.5 mV, lasting 20 milliseconds. Miniature end plate potentials depolarize synapse by 0.7 mV, lasting 10 milliseconds. Frequency is directly proportional to membrane depolarization. Frequency is five per second at membrane resting voltage.
